Node.js 如何安装Grunt任务运行程序?

Node.js 如何安装Grunt任务运行程序?,node.js,gruntjs,Node.js,Gruntjs,我正在尝试安装Grunt(在Windows上) 文档()说明安装grunt cli,并说明这不是grunt任务运行程序,而是允许从任何文件夹运行grunt命令的程序。好啊好的我已经做到了。我的下一个问题是,;如何安装Grunt任务运行程序。这些文档的含义是,它将在本地安装在我的项目目录中 我该怎么做 该项目已经有一个Gruntfile.js和一个package.json&在另一台机器上工作。我只是想让它在本地运行 具体而言,我得到了以下信息: “…找不到Gruntfile或Grunt未在项目本地

我正在尝试安装Grunt(在Windows上)

文档()说明安装grunt cli,并说明这不是grunt任务运行程序,而是允许从任何文件夹运行grunt命令的程序。好啊好的我已经做到了。我的下一个问题是,;如何安装Grunt任务运行程序。这些文档的含义是,它将在本地安装在我的项目目录中

我该怎么做

该项目已经有一个Gruntfile.js和一个package.json&在另一台机器上工作。我只是想让它在本地运行

具体而言,我得到了以下信息:

“…找不到Gruntfile或Grunt未在项目本地安装”

谢谢

--Justin Wyllie

npm安装--保存dev grunt
以像任何模块一样安装它,并将其作为开发依赖项添加到您的
package.json
文件中


grunt
也可能已经列为依赖项,在这种情况下,您可能只需要运行
npm install
来安装所有依赖项。

还需要注意的是,由于项目在另一台机器上工作,grunt可能已经在他的package.json中列为开发依赖项。如果是这种情况,Grunt和项目的所有其他npm依赖项都可以通过
npm install
Ok在本地安装。这是和只是做npm安装工作。谢谢在package.json中有一个值为“grunt.js”的字段“main”。但是grunt正在使用Grunfile.js。(grunt.js与以前的一个项目有关联,我可以摆脱它)。但是“main”字段是关于什么的呢?另外,对不起,目录节点模块需要在那里吗?这可以放在grunt cli所在的主系统位置吗?通常每个节点项目都有自己的
node\u modules
文件夹,用于其特定的依赖项版本
main
定义当您
需要(…)
模块时加载的文件,因此在这种情况下,需要模块的模块将从
grunt.js
返回
exports
对象。